#b9c100 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b9c100 is composed of 72.5% red, 75.7%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 4.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 62.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 37.8%. #b9c100 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#738300.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

Shades and Tints of #b9c100

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#101000 is the darkest color, while #fffffc is the lightest one.

Tones of #b9c100

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#676859 is the less saturated color, while #b9c100 is the most saturated one.
